General Description

A 66 Challenger convertible assessment of condition

Comments

Challenger A66 convertible was in storage since 1984
Starting to assess condition and type of restoration to take place.
In searching for build sheet, not found yet, deteriorated rugs removed
Floors show no rot, just surface rust. Passenger side front was almost mint.
Underside of car floor in this area solid, and very little service rust.
Trunk floor and rear quarter bottoms appear to be only area that is in need of new sheet metal, so far.
 
I added shots of my A66 Challenger taken at a car meet in 1981 when it was on the road and in very good condition
